How did Democrat Woodrow<br> Wilson win the election of 1912?
Delicious77 [7]

Answer:

Wilson took advantage of the Republican split, winning 40 states and a large majority of the electoral vote

Who has the power to review all laws and treaties of the united states
MakcuM [25]

Answer:

The Judicial Branch

Explanation:

The Judicial Branch has the power to review all laws and treaties of the U.S. to make sure they are legal and settle disputes involving the United States.
